The invention relates to a labelled biotin compound, wherein said biotin compound is represented by general formula (I) wherein: n is 1 or 2, R is a chelating group for chelating a metal atom, and Sp is a spacing group having at least 4 atoms spacing NH from R; and wherein said biotin compound is labelled with a metal atom selected from (a) the group consisting of the radioactive isotopes 99mTc, 203Pb, 66Ga, 67Ga, 68Ga, 72As, 111In, 113mIn, 114mIn, 97Ru, 62Cu, 64Cu, 52Fe, 52mMn, 51Cr, 186Re, 188Re, 77As, 90Y, 67Cu, 169Er, 117mSn, 121Sn, 127Te, 142Pr, 143Pr, 198Au, 199Au, 149Tb, 161Tb, 109Pd, 165Dy, 149Pm, 151Pm, 153Sm, 157Gd, 166Ho, 172Tm, 169Yb, 175Yb, 177Lu, 105Rh and 111Ag or (b) the group consisting of the paramagnetic metal atoms Cr, Mn, Fe, Co, Ni, Cu, Pr, Nd, Sm, Yb, Gd, Tb, Dy, Ho and Er; said metal atom being attached to the biotin compound by means of said chelating group. The invention further relates to a pharmaceutical composition comprising said labelled biotin compound, to the use of said composition for diagnosis and therapy, and to a kit for preparing a radiopharmaceutical composition.
